Your domain

This is a channel/partner role — defined by how you sell, not by which market. You own the partner-driven motion across both markets below; direct-sold relationships stay with the core team and the CSO.

Market 1 — Utilities buying distributed capacity. Utilities are squeezed on two fronts: speed (load growth outrunning what they can build) and affordability (rate pressure from regulators and ratepayers). Standardized 1–20 MW battery/generator installations answer both — deployed in months, and cheaper than the substation and wire upgrades they let utilities defer. Two segments: large investor-owned utilities and cooperatives / city utilities (single projects, 6–18 months).

Market 2 — C&I customers buying speed and reliability. Businesses staring down multi-year interconnection waits, buying onsite power to open sooner with bridging or flexible interconnection. Our niche is under-20 MW generator + battery + solar systems
